
Stay Steady
The Stay Steady program is designed to help individuals improve balance, strength, and coordination to reduce the risk of falls and maintain independence. Falls are a leading cause of injury, particularly for older adults or those with mobility challenges. This program focuses on targeted exercises, education, and confidence-building strategies to enhance stability and prevent falls before they happen.
Led by experienced physiotherapists and exercise physiologists, Stay Steady supports individuals who feel unsteady on their feet, have a history of falls, or want to maintain their mobility and independence as they age.
What to Expect:
✔ Balance & Stability Training – Improve coordination and reduce fall risk.
✔ Lower Body & Core Strengthening – Build muscle to support movement and posture.
✔ Gait & Walking Techniques – Enhance mobility and confidence on different surfaces.
✔ Fall Prevention Strategies – Learn techniques to stay steady and react safely.
✔ Education & Self-Management – Gain the knowledge to maintain long-term stability.
Who Can Benefit?
Older adults looking to maintain independence and prevent falls.
Individuals with dizziness, poor balance, or weakness.
Those recovering from injury, surgery, or neurological conditions affecting movement.
Anyone who has experienced a fall or near-fall and wants to improve confidence.
Funding & Payment Options
NDIS – For eligible participants requiring fall prevention support.
Medicare – Available through a Chronic Disease Management Plan with a GP referral.
Private Health Insurance – May be claimable under allied health extras.
DVA (Department of Veterans’ Affairs) – For eligible veterans.
Workers’ Compensation & Return to Work SA – For approved cases.
